Long-term use of common heartburn pills is tied to higher kidney and dementia risk

Proton-pump inhibitors, the widely used medications that quell heartburn and acid reflux, are among the most commonly taken drugs in the world, available both by prescription and over the counter. A growing body of research has linked their long-term use to higher risks of kidney problems and, in some studies, dementia, prompting doctors to urge caution about taking them for years without review. The associations do not prove the drugs cause those conditions, but they have reshaped how physicians think about prescribing them.

What proton-pump inhibitors do

Proton-pump inhibitors, or PPIs, work by shutting down the pumps in the stomach lining that produce acid. That makes them highly effective for conditions driven by excess acid, including gastroesophageal reflux disease, ulcers and inflammation of the esophagus. Common examples include omeprazole, esomeprazole, lansoprazole and pantoprazole. The National Institute of Diabetes and Digestive and Kidney Diseases describes PPIs as a mainstay for treating acid reflux and GERD, conditions that affect a large share of adults.

Their effectiveness and easy availability have made them extraordinarily popular, and that is precisely where the concern arises. The drugs were designed and studied for relatively short courses, often eight weeks or less, but many people take them continuously for years, sometimes without a clear ongoing medical need. It is this prolonged, often unsupervised use that the newer research has scrutinized.

The kidney findings

Several large observational studies have reported that long-term PPI use is associated with a higher risk of chronic kidney disease and acute kidney injury. Researchers have proposed that the drugs may occasionally trigger a form of kidney inflammation, and that repeated or unnoticed episodes could contribute to lasting damage over time. Because chronic kidney disease often progresses silently, such harm can accumulate without obvious symptoms until kidney function is substantially reduced. Guidance on protecting kidney health from the same federal institute emphasizes monitoring for people with risk factors for kidney disease, a category that some studies suggest may include long-term PPI users.

The kidney associations have been consistent enough across multiple studies to draw clinical attention, though they remain associations. Observational research can identify a statistical link but cannot by itself establish that the drug caused the outcome, because people who take PPIs long-term may differ in other ways, such as age, overall health or other medications, that also affect kidney function.

The dementia question

The possible link to dementia has been more contested. Some studies, particularly earlier analyses of older adults, reported that regular PPI users had a higher rate of dementia diagnoses, and researchers speculated about mechanisms, including effects on the clearance of amyloid proteins in the brain or on absorption of vitamin B12, a nutrient important for nerve health. Subsequent studies, however, produced conflicting results, with some finding no clear association once other factors were accounted for. The evidence on dementia is therefore weaker and less consistent than the kidney findings, and reporting compiled by health-focused outlets such as the health section of ScienceDaily has reflected that ongoing scientific debate.

Beyond kidneys and cognition, long-term PPI use has been tied in various studies to other potential harms, including deficiencies in vitamin B12 and magnesium, an increased risk of certain intestinal infections such as Clostridioides difficile, and a modestly higher risk of bone fractures. As with the kidney and dementia data, most of these findings come from observational research and describe associations rather than proven cause and effect.

Why doctors still prescribe them

Despite the concerns, PPIs remain valuable and, for many patients, the best available treatment. For serious conditions such as bleeding ulcers, severe reflux or Barrett’s esophagus, the benefits clearly outweigh the potential risks, and stopping the drugs abruptly can cause a rebound surge in acid. The clinical response to the research has not been to abandon PPIs but to use them more deliberately: prescribing the lowest effective dose for the shortest necessary duration, and periodically reassessing whether continued use is warranted. The Food and Drug Administration, which regulates these drugs, maintains labeling and safety information for approved medications, including PPIs.

Physicians increasingly recommend “deprescribing” for patients who have been on PPIs for years without a strong ongoing indication, tapering the dose to avoid rebound acid and, where appropriate, switching to alternatives such as lifestyle changes or less potent acid reducers. For milder reflux, dietary and behavioral measures, weight management and avoiding trigger foods can reduce or eliminate the need for daily acid suppression.

Weighing the evidence

The overall message from the research is one of caution rather than alarm. The kidney associations are reasonably consistent and biologically plausible, the dementia link is uncertain and disputed, and none of the findings establish that PPIs directly cause these outcomes. For patients, the practical takeaway is to use the drugs when genuinely needed, at the lowest effective dose, and to review long-term use with a clinician rather than continuing indefinitely by default.

Ongoing research continues to refine the picture, including studies designed to better separate the drugs’ effects from the characteristics of the people who take them. Until that work resolves the open questions, the prudent course endorsed by many physicians is straightforward: treat real acid-related disease with PPIs confidently, but avoid taking powerful acid-suppressing medication for years on end without a clear and current reason.
